Royals Football Attend 7 on 7 event at Flomaton

@ Flomaton- The Jay Royals squared off against three other schools in a 7 on 7 event that included lineman challenges. Schools in attendance were Flomaton, Georgiana, St. Lukes Academy, and Jay. Jay travels to Flomaton for the annual rivalry game on August 25.
